Default How do I reverse an import? I imported 46,000 contacts from .xls

Delete those entries or all the entries. You can't "reverse" it by File |
Import and Export.
View your contacts folder in a phone list view and sort my modified (you
might need to add that field to the view) and you should be able to locate
those newly imported contacts to delete them.
